Comment analyser les données de paquets dans Wireshark pour les enquêtes en cybersécurité

WiresharkWiresharkBeginner
Pratiquer maintenant

💡 Ce tutoriel est traduit par l'IA à partir de la version anglaise. Pour voir la version originale, vous pouvez cliquer ici

Introduction

Ce tutoriel vous guidera tout au long du processus d'analyse des données de paquets dans Wireshark, un puissant analyseur de protocoles réseau, afin de soutenir vos enquêtes en cybersécurité. En maîtrisant ces techniques, vous serez en mesure d'identifier les anomalies réseau, de détecter les menaces de sécurité et de recueillir des informations précieuses pour renforcer la posture de sécurité globale de votre organisation.

Introduction à Wireshark et à l'analyse des paquets réseau

Qu'est-ce que Wireshark?

Wireshark est un puissant analyseur de protocoles réseau open source qui vous permet de capturer, d'analyser et de résoudre les problèmes de trafic réseau. Il est largement utilisé par les administrateurs de réseau, les professionnels de la sécurité et les développeurs pour comprendre la communication réseau, identifier les menaces de sécurité et diagnostiquer les problèmes de réseau.

L'importance de l'analyse des paquets réseau

L'analyse des paquets réseau est une compétence cruciale dans le domaine de la cybersécurité. En examinant les paquets de données circulant dans un réseau, les professionnels de la sécurité peuvent détecter et enquêter sur divers types d'attaques basées sur le réseau, telles que l'accès non autorisé, les violations de données et les infections par des logiciels malveillants. L'analyse des données de paquets peut fournir des informations précieuses sur le comportement du trafic réseau, aidant à identifier les anomalies, les activités suspectes et les vulnérabilités de sécurité potentiellement dangereuses.

Caractéristiques clés de Wireshark

Wireshark offre une large gamme de fonctionnalités qui le rendent un outil incontournable pour l'analyse des paquets réseau :

  • Capture de paquets : Wireshark peut capturer le trafic réseau à partir de diverses interfaces réseau, y compris les connexions câblées et sans fil.
  • Décodage des paquets : Wireshark peut décoder et afficher le contenu des paquets réseau, fournissant des informations détaillées sur les différentes couches de protocole et leurs données correspondantes.
  • Filtrer et rechercher : Wireshark permet aux utilisateurs de filtrer et de rechercher les paquets capturés selon divers critères, tels que le protocole, l'adresse IP, le numéro de port, etc.
  • Analyse de protocole : Wireshark prend en charge l'analyse de centaines de protocoles réseau, ce qui en fait un outil complet pour comprendre la communication réseau.
  • Rapports et visualisation : Wireshark propose diverses options pour générer des rapports et visualiser les données réseau, telles que des graphiques et des statistiques.

Applications pratiques de Wireshark

Wireshark est largement utilisé dans les scénarios liés à la cybersécurité suivants :

  • Réponse aux incidents : L'analyse des données de paquets peut aider les équipes de sécurité à enquêter et à répondre aux incidents de sécurité, tels que les violations de données, les infections par des logiciels malveillants et les tentatives d'accès non autorisé.
  • Dépannage réseau : Wireshark peut être utilisé pour identifier et résoudre les problèmes de performance réseau, les problèmes de connectivité et les échecs de communication.
  • Surveillance de la sécurité : La surveillance continue du trafic réseau à l'aide de Wireshark peut aider à détecter et à prévenir les menaces de sécurité, telles que l'accès non autorisé, l'exfiltration de données et l'activité de logiciels malveillants.
  • Audit de conformité et de réglementation : Wireshark peut être utilisé pour capturer et analyser le trafic réseau pour s'assurer du respect des normes et des exigences de sécurité de l'industrie.

Commencer avec Wireshark

Pour commencer avec Wireshark, vous devrez l'installer sur votre système. Wireshark est disponible pour divers systèmes d'exploitation, y compris Windows, macOS et Linux. Pour ce tutoriel, nous utiliserons Ubuntu 22.04 comme exemple d'exploitation.

## Installer Wireshark sur Ubuntu 22.04
sudo apt-get update
sudo apt-get install wireshark

Une fois Wireshark installé, vous pouvez lancer l'application et commencer à capturer et à analyser le trafic réseau.

Capturer et filtrer les données de paquets dans Wireshark

Capturer le trafic réseau

Pour capturer le trafic réseau à l'aide de Wireshark, suivez ces étapes :

  1. Lancez l'application Wireshark.
  2. Sélectionnez l'interface réseau appropriée dans la liste des interfaces disponibles.
  3. Cliquez sur le bouton "Démarrer" pour commencer la capture de paquets.
  4. Wireshark va maintenant commencer à capturer tout le trafic réseau passant par l'interface sélectionnée.
graph TD A[Lancez Wireshark] --> B[Sélectionnez l'interface réseau] B --> C[Cliquez sur le bouton "Démarrer"] C --> D[Capturez le trafic réseau]

Filtrer les données de paquets

Wireshark offre des capacités de filtrage puissantes pour vous aider à vous concentrer sur des types spécifiques de trafic réseau. Vous pouvez utiliser la barre de filtrage d'affichage en haut de la fenêtre Wireshark pour appliquer divers filtres. Voici quelques exemples de filtres courants :

Filtre Description
ip.addr == 192.168.1.100 Affiche les paquets avec l'adresse IP 192.168.1.100
tcp.port == 80 Affiche les paquets avec le port TCP 80 (HTTP)
http Affiche uniquement les paquets HTTP
not arp Affiche tous les paquets sauf les paquets ARP

Pour appliquer un filtre, il suffit de taper l'expression de filtre dans la barre de filtrage d'affichage et d'appuyer sur Entrée. Wireshark mettra à jour la liste de paquets pour afficher uniquement les paquets qui correspondent au filtre appliqué.

## Exemple : Capturer et filtrer le trafic HTTP sur Ubuntu 22.04
sudo wireshark -i eth0 -f "tcp port 80"

Cette commande lancera Wireshark et commencera à capturer le trafic réseau sur l'interface eth0, en filtrant les paquets avec le port TCP 80 (HTTP).

Techniques de filtrage avancées

Wireshark prend également en charge des techniques de filtrage plus avancées, telles que :

  • Combiner plusieurs filtres à l'aide d'opérateurs booléens (par exemple, ip.addr == 192.168.1.100 and tcp.port == 80)
  • Utiliser des expressions régulières pour une correspondance de motifs plus complexe
  • Enregistrer et charger des profils de filtrage personnalisés pour un accès rapide

En maîtrisant l'art du filtrage, vous pouvez concentrer efficacement votre analyse de paquets sur les données spécifiques qui sont pertinentes pour vos enquêtes en cybersécurité.

Analyser les données de paquets pour les enquêtes en cybersécurité

Scénarios courants de cybersécurité

Wireshark peut être un outil précieux pour analyser le trafic réseau dans divers scénarios de cybersécurité, tels que :

  • Détecter des logiciels malveillants et des activités suspectes : L'analyse des données de paquets peut aider à identifier la présence de logiciels malveillants, d'activités de botnets ou d'autres types de trafic malveillant.
  • Enquêter sur les violations de données : L'analyse des paquets peut fournir des informations sur la manière dont un attaquant a obtenu un accès non autorisé, quelles données ont été exfiltrées et les méthodes utilisées.
  • Identifier les vulnérabilités du réseau : L'examen du trafic réseau peut révéler des vulnérabilités de sécurité potentiellement dangereuses, telles que des systèmes non mis à jour ou des services mal configurés.
  • Surveiller les questions de conformité et de réglementation : L'analyse des paquets peut aider à s'assurer que les activités réseau sont conformes aux normes et exigences de sécurité de l'industrie.

Analyser les données de paquets

Lorsque vous analysez les données de paquets pour les enquêtes en cybersécurité, vous pouvez vous concentrer sur les domaines clés suivants :

Analyse de protocole

Examinez les différentes couches de protocole (par exemple, Ethernet, IP, TCP, HTTP) pour comprendre les modèles de communication et identifier toute anomalie ou activité suspecte.

Vérification de la charge utile

Inspectez la charge utile ou le contenu des paquets à la recherche d'indicateurs de compromise, tels que des transferts de fichiers inhabituels, des exécutions de commandes ou des exfiltrations de données.

Détection d'anomalies

Cherchez des modèles inhabituels, une utilisation inhabituelle de protocole ou des écarts par rapport au comportement normal du réseau qui pourraient indiquer un incident de sécurité.

Corrélation et analyse contextuelle

Corrigez les données de paquets avec d'autres sources d'informations, telles que les journaux, la topologie du réseau ou les renseignements sur les menaces, pour mieux comprendre l'événement de sécurité.

Exemple pratique : Détecter une activité de logiciel malveillant

Considérons un scénario où vous soupçonnez qu'un système de votre réseau est infecté par un logiciel malveillant. Vous pouvez utiliser Wireshark pour analyser le trafic réseau et enquêter sur le problème.

## Capturez le trafic réseau sur Ubuntu 22.04
sudo wireshark -i eth0
  1. Appliquez un filtre pour afficher uniquement le trafic vers/à partir du système soupçonné d'être infecté, par exemple ip.addr == 192.168.1.100.
  2. Examinez la hiérarchie des protocoles et recherchez tout protocole inhabituel ou suspect, tels que ceux associés à des familles de logiciels malveillants connues.
  3. Inspectez les charges utiles des paquets à la recherche d'indicateurs de compromise, tels que des transferts de fichiers inhabituels, des exécutions de commandes ou des exfiltrations de données.
  4. Corrigez les données de paquets avec d'autres sources d'informations, telles que les journaux système ou les renseignements sur les menaces, pour mieux comprendre l'activité potentielle de logiciel malveillant.

En suivant ce processus, vous pouvez utiliser Wireshark pour identifier et enquêter sur les incidents de sécurité potentiels, aidant à atténuer l'impact des menaces cybernétiques.

Sommaire

Dans ce tutoriel complet de cybersécurité, vous allez apprendre à utiliser efficacement Wireshark pour l'analyse des données de paquets. Du captage et du filtrage du trafic réseau à l'identification d'incidents de sécurité potentiels, ce guide vous fournira les compétences nécessaires pour mener des enquêtes approfondies en cybersécurité et renforcer les mesures de sécurité de votre organisation.